ASHLAND, Wis. - Northland College (1-7, 1-5 NCHA) played hard tonight against the Falcons of University of Wisconsin River Falls (6-0, 0-0 WIAC) with a score of 3-0.

The Jacks didn't come out strong as the Falcons scored within a minute of the puck dropping. This seemed to boost the intensity for the Jacks, however, they were able to get 12 shots in the first period. In the second period Northland came out just as they left off, strong. It was a battle the whole time during the second period. Neither team was giving an inch. The Falcons scored late in the second period putting the score at 2-0. This takes us to the end of the second period. UW River Falls scored early in the third period. Northland had 19 shots on goal they just couldn't seem to catch a break as the game would end with a score of 3-0.

Jessie DiLillo ended the game with 25 saves.
